Note: If the above descriptions are inapplicable to troubleshooting, do not disassemble and repair it yourself. Repairs
carried out by inexperienced persons may cause injury or serious malfunctioning. Contact the local store where your
purchase was made. This product should be serviced by an authorized engineer and only genuine spare parts should be
used.
When the appliance is not in use for long periods, disconnect from the electricity supply, empty all foods and clean the
appliance, leaving the door ajar to prevent unpleasant smells.

Electrical information
This electrical appliance must be grounded.
This product is equipped with a plug, which is suitable for all houses equipped with sockets meeting the current
specifications
If the fitted plug is not suitable for your socket outlets, it should be cut off and carefully disposed of. To avoid a possible
shock hazard, do not insert the discarded plug into a socket.
This product complies the EEC directives.

Safe recovery instructions
Disposal
Old appliances still have some surplus value. An environmentally friendly approach will ensure that valuable raw materials
are recycled.
The refrigerants used in your equipment and insulation materials require special handling procedures. Make sure there is
no pipe damage on the back of the equipment before handling.
Up-to-date information on the options for disposing of old equipment and packaging from old equipment can be obtained
from the local municipal office.

This marking indicates that this product should not be disposed with other household wastes
throughout the EU. To prevent possible harm to the environment or human health from uncontrolled
waste disposal, recycle it responsibly to promote the sustainable reuse of material resources. To
return your used device, please use the return and collection systems or contact the retailer where the
product was purchased. They can take this product for environmentally safe recycling.
